<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?><!DOCTYPE Zthes SYSTEM "http://zthes.z3950.org/xml/zthes-05.dtd">  <Zthes><term><termId>31485954</termId><termName>stamped banknotes</termName><termType>PT</termType><termNote><![CDATA[ In the age of forgeries, banknotes were submitted to banks for authentication using stamps (either dry or ink), which indicated their legitimacy. This method was commonly used during the 19th century. ]]></termNote><termCreatedDate>2026-03-30 20:56:15</termCreatedDate><relation><relationType>UF</relationType><termId>31485955</termId><termName>stamped banknote</termName><termType>ND</termType></relation><relation><relationType>BT</relationType><termId>31401123</termId><termName>paper money by form or function</termName><termType>PT</termType></relation></term>  </Zthes>
